Scooter won't start

My scooter is completely dead and won't switch on. The battery is charged, I pressed the reset button and put in a new fuse for the control panel as the old one had blown. The scooter switched on with the new fuse, but then went dead again.

SOURCE: Scooter has full charge but still won't go.

It probably means that the connections or wiring from your battery are loose or broken. When you add the extra current required to run the motors, the voltage is being lost. Monitor the battery voltage with a meter while trying to drive the scooter will prove this.

SOURCE: pride victory Scooter battery charged won't run

Its probably too late to give my opinion, but here goes anyway.
I had a similar problem with my mothers scooter and it turned out to be a faulty connection on the wires leading to the motor. I simply pulled the plastic connection apart, cleaned and lubricated the contacts, refitted the connection and all was well.
